> > > pci_epf_test_enable_doorbell() allocates a doorbell and then installs
> > > the interrupt handler with request_threaded_irq(). On failures before
> > > the IRQ is successfully requested (e.g. no free BAR,
> > > request_threaded_irq() failure), the error path jumps to
> > > err_doorbell_cleanup and calls pci_epf_test_doorbell_cleanup().
> > >
> > > pci_epf_test_doorbell_cleanup() unconditionally calls free_irq() for the
> > > doorbell virq, which can trigger "Trying to free already-free IRQ"
> > > warnings when the IRQ was never requested.
> > >
> > > Track whether the doorbell IRQ has been successfully requested and only
> > > call free_irq() when it has.

> > Another bug in pci_epf_test_enable_doorbell():
> >
> > Since we reuse the BAR size, and use dynamic inbound mapping,
> > what if the returned DB offset is larger than epf->bar[bar].size ?
> >
> > I think we need something like this before calling pci_epc_set_bar():
> >
> > if (reg->doorbell_offset >= epf->bar[bar].size)
> > goto err_doorbell_cleanup;
